Blade device for rapidly cleaning wind power generation
Technical Field
The utility model relates to a wind power generation technical field specifically is a wash paddle device on wind power generation fast.
Background
Wind power generation refers to converting kinetic energy of wind into electric energy, and wind energy is a clean and pollution-free renewable energy source; the blade is an important part on wind power generation equipment, in the prior art, the blade is generally produced and assembled in a factory, a blade assembly which is just processed generally needs to be cleaned before the blade is assembled, and the existing cleaning equipment can only clean one part of the part at the same time when the blade assembly is cleaned, so that a large amount of time is consumed for cleaning the whole part, and the cleaning efficiency is low.
In the patent application number of the Chinese utility model: CN202021298698.7 discloses a device for rapidly cleaning blades on wind power generation, which comprises a base, wherein two parallel supports are symmetrically arranged at the edge of the top surface of the base, two sliding chutes are symmetrically arranged on the supports, two parallel mounting plates are symmetrically and tightly welded on the outer side walls of the supports, and the mounting plates are all fixedly connected with cylinders through bolts; and a rectangular frame is arranged between the two supports. This wash paddle device on wind power generation fast, unable according to paddle radian adjustment washing angle in the use, it still can't fix the paddle that washs the thickness and differs.
Therefore, there is a need to provide a device for rapidly cleaning blades in wind power generation to solve the above problems.

Referring to fig. 1-4, a blade device for rapidly cleaning wind power generation comprises a mounting plate 1, wherein a rotating plate 2 is symmetrically and fixedly connected to two sides of the upper surface of the mounting plate 1, a spring groove 3 is formed in the inner wall of the rotating plate 2, an upper spring 4 is fixedly connected to the upper surface of the inner wall of the spring groove 3, a lower spring 5 is fixedly connected to the lower surface of the inner wall of the spring groove 3, a limiting block 6 is fixedly connected to the other end of the upper spring 4, a limiting groove 7 is formed in the outer wall of the rotating plate 2, the limiting groove 7 is slidably connected with the limiting block 6, the limiting block 6 can be prevented from being inclined to cause damage to the device structure, the lower surface of the limiting block 6 is fixedly connected with the lower spring 5, a rotating motor 8 is fixedly connected to the outer wall of the limiting block 6, fixing plates 16 are fixedly connected to two sides of the outer wall of the rotating motor 8, a plurality of spray nozzles 17 are fixedly connected to the outer wall of the fixing plates 16, the plurality of spray heads 17 are uniformly distributed on the surface of the fixing plate 16, the plurality of spray heads 17 can spray water in all directions to prevent incomplete cleaning, the output shaft of the rotating motor 8 is fixedly connected with the rotating shaft 9, the outer wall of the rotating shaft 9 is fixedly connected with the roller 10, the outer wall of the roller 10 is fixedly connected with the brush 11, the roller 10 can be always parallel to the blade surface by arranging the upper spring 4, the lower spring 5 and the limiting block 6, the problem that the blade surface is unclean due to radian and the roller 10 cannot be parallel to the liquid surface can be avoided, the aim of rotating and adjusting the cleaning angle along with the radian of the blade surface is fulfilled, the roller 10 can be rotated by the rotating motor 8 by arranging the rotating motor 8, the roller 10 and the brush 11, the blade surface is quickly rubbed by the brush 11, and the rapid cleaning effect can be achieved, meanwhile, the problem of unclean flushing is avoided, the outer wall of the rotating motor 8 is provided with a sliding rail 12, the outer wall of the sliding rail 12 is fixedly connected with an electric slider 13, the electric slider 13 can slide on the sliding rail 12, so that the distance between the fixed wheels 15 is enlarged or reduced, the fixed wheels are adapted to blades with different thicknesses, or positions with different thicknesses of the same blade, so that the fixed wheels 15 can always fix and convey the blades to bear gravity, the outer wall of the electric slider 13 is fixedly connected with a fixed shaft 14, the outer wall of the fixed shaft 14 is sleeved with the fixed wheels 15, the outer wall of the fixed plate 16 is fixedly connected with a pump 18, the input end of the pump 18 is fixedly connected with a cleaning agent bottle 19, the output end of the pump 18 is fixedly connected with a pump head 20, the pump head 20 can spray cleaning agents to different angles, the joint of the pump 18 and the fixed plate 16 is provided with a screw 21, and the screw 21 is convenient for fixing and detaching the pump 18, the lower surface bilateral symmetry fixedly connected with base 22 of mounting panel 1, slide rail 12 is equipped with the constant head tank with electric slider 13's linking department, the constant head tank is convenient for electric slider 13 to fix own position, through setting up slide rail 12, electric slider 13, fixed axle 14 and tight pulley 15 can utilize electric slider 13 to move on slide rail 12 according to the thickness of paddle, thereby enlarge or reduce the distance between the tight pulley 15, thereby the paddle of the different thickness of adaptation, or the position of the different thickness of same paddle, make tight pulley 15 can fix the conveying paddle all the time and bear gravity, thereby the paddle of the different thickness of fixed conveying of being convenient for, but the operating range of device has been improved, it can follow in the cleaner bottle 19 to extract the cleaner and utilize pump head 20 to spray to the paddle to set up pump 18, the clean degree of device to the paddle has effectively been improved.
The electrical components presented in the document are all electrically connected with an external master controller and 220V mains, and the master controller can be a conventional known device controlled by a computer or the like.
The working principle is as follows: the cleaning device can be used in cooperation with a conveyor belt, the distance between two fixed wheels 15 is adjusted by moving an electric sliding block 13 on a sliding rail 12, the fixed wheels 15 are attached to the surfaces of blades, a rotating motor 8 is started, a roller 10 is rotated, a spray head 17 is simultaneously opened to start water spraying, the conveyor belt is opened, the blades are clamped by the fixed wheels 15, when the blades are in arc surfaces, a limiting block 6 moves in a spring groove 3 to compress an upper spring 4 or a lower spring 5, the roller 10 can be parallel to the surfaces of the blades, the problem that the cleaning is not clean due to the fact that a brush 11 cannot contact with the liquid level of the blades can be avoided, the roller 10 rotates, the brush 11 cleans the surfaces of the blades, the spray head 17 continuously sprays water to flush the cleaning agent, if the blades are dirty, the cleaning agent can be continuously extracted from a bottle 19 by opening a pump 18, the cleaning agent can be sprayed to the surfaces of the blades through a pump head 20, the cleaning force is further increased, the upper spring 4 and the lower spring 5 can reset devices after the cleaning is completed, and the cleaning device does not need to be manually centered.
